The contract is for the procurement of firemen’s structural gloves, specifically part number LPG928BK in size L (NSN 8415-01-737-8691), with a quantity of 15 pairs to be delivered within 20 days FOB destination. The gloves are certified to NFPA standards and feature a three-piece back-of-hand design for enhanced flexibility and grip, constructed from Eversoft water-repellent thermal cowhide split leather with Lite N Dri cushioning for knuckle protection. Integrated Kovenex thermal fabric provides superior resistance to heat, flame, cuts, and tears, while a Gore Crosstech insert ensures breathable, liquid-proof protection. All items must comply with DLA Master List of Technical and Quality Requirements and cannot deviate from specified materials or construction. Packaging must adhere to MIL-STD-129 labeling and DLA packaging guidelines, with commercial packaging per ASTM D3951 only acceptable if the item is not classified as hazardous under FED-STD-313. Palletization must follow RP001 requirements, and no parcel post is permitted for shipment. Deliveries must be traceable and sent to the specified freight address at Cherry Point, North Carolina, with inspection and acceptance occurring at the delivery point and no tolerance allowed for quantity variance. The contract is issued under solicitation SPE8EZ-26-T-0026 by the Defense Logistics Agency, with a required delivery date of April 14, 2026, and the point of contact is Robert Singley.

Fire Fighter's EnsembleThe Solicitation N6278626Q0005 issued by the Supervisor of Shipbuilding, Conversion and Repair, Bath (SUPSHIP Bath), seeks the procurement of Honeywell Morning Pride Firefighter Ensembles (FFE) for use by Civilian Mariner Crew Members and Navy personnel during shipboard fire emergencies. This requirement specifies brand-new, unaltered two-piece ensembles consisting of turnout coats and turnout pants in bronze color, model LTO 96I3, manufactured exclusively in the United States and compliant with NFPA 1971-2013 (and the latest edition), as well as OSHA Standard 29 CFR 1910.1030. The brand name Honeywell is mandatory; no grey market, refurbished, or non-original products will be accepted. The solicitation has been amended to remove the prior small business set aside, allowing large businesses to compete, but only direct authorized resellers with documented certification of manufacturer-approved distribution channels for federal sales are eligible. Submittals must include full pricing per line item inclusive of all shipping costs under FOB Destination San Diego, CA, along with delivery lead time, product verification, and company details including CAGE Code, UEI/DUNS number, SAM.gov registration, and small business status. The delivery location is 8511 Kerns St., Dock 5, San Diego, CA 92154, with a maximum delivery window of 60 days after receipt of order, though faster delivery may receive preference. Quotes must remain valid for 30 days past the closing date and are to be submitted via email to the designated government contacts. The evaluation will be based on a Firm-Fixed-Price contract award determined by Best Value, with technical acceptability—including compliance with brand name, country of origin, and safety standards—as a mandatory pass/fail gate. Price, delivery schedule, and past performance are weighted factors in the selection. The solicitation incorporates numerous FAR and DFARS clauses addressing cybersecurity, information safeguarding, payment procedures, export controls, whistleblower rights, and supplier restrictions, including the requirement for NIST SP 800-171 compliance and the prohibition on ByteDance-related applications. Payment will be processed through Wide Area Workflow and electronic submission systems. All submissions are subject to review for responsiveness, and failure to meet any mandatory requirement will result in non-responsiveness. The Government retains full discretion to reject any or all offers without obligation.

Future Soldier T-shirtsThis contract, issued under solicitation number W9124D26QA279 by the W6QM Micc-Ft Knox office of the Department of Defense, mandates the production, printing, packaging, and distribution of 75,000 US Army Future Soldier T-shirts to 69 Military Entrance Processing Stations, 38 Battalions, and the US Army Recruiting Division Headquarters. The contractor is responsible for all costs related to freight and shipping, including deliveries to overseas locations, and must comply with the Berry Amendment, requiring all textile materials and manufacturing to be wholly of U.S. origin. The shirts must feature specific artwork—including the American Flag on the right sleeve, the Army Logo on the front, and BAYCB on the back—with each shirt individually folded and packaged in a clear poly bag clearly labeled with size, and shipped in boxes by size according to strict guidelines: no more than 50 shirts per box for MEPS and USARD deliveries, with international shipments not exceeding 70 pounds or 108 inches in combined length and girth. All outer cartons must include the contract number, purchase order number, size, quantity, and final destination address, with no barcoding or machine-readable labels required. The solicitation is a Small Business Set-Aside under NAICS code 315210 and will result in a firm-fixed-price award to the lowest-priced, technically acceptable offeror on a Lowest Price Technically Acceptable (LPTA) basis, with no trade-offs allowed between cost and technical factors. Technical acceptability hinges on compliance with the Berry Amendment, SAM.gov registration, and adherence to packaging, labeling, and distribution requirements outlined in the Statement of Work and supporting attachments, including updated artwork and the distribution list. The response deadline has been extended to August 3, 2026, at 10:00 AM EDT, and proposals must be submitted electronically via email to the designated contracting officers. Delivery of all T-shirts must be completed by November 19, 2026, with final acceptance centralized at Fort Knox, Kentucky, under F.O.B. Destination terms. The contractor must maintain active SAM.gov registration, comply with all applicable FAR and DFARS clauses including restrictions on subcontractor sales, whistleblower rights, executive compensation reporting, and prohibitions on certain foreign telecommunications equipment and interrogation practices, and submit documentation affirming U.S.-only sourcing throughout the supply chain.
